All of our triples are 70/90/70, with these you have the benefit of the 70 duro, perfect for plastison, the 90 keeps it stiff and stops flexing. I also have a bunch of unmounted 80 duros single, these I use for 4cp or graphic ink. I just swap them out from the squeegee holder when needed. Like I said if you use a low duro like 60, a 110 screen you can lay down a lot of ink like a white, it is really good for solid blocking and numbers, anything else forget it since it is so thick. good luck. | ||
